Dr Meena Khatwa and Dr Kelly Dickson delve into the bio-psychosocial impacts of menopause with special guests Lauren Chiren (CEO, Women of a Certain Stage); Sonia Abrams (UCL Head of Events OPVA) and Josephine Falade (Associate Professor, UCL School of Pharmacy). Together, they explore menopause awareness, acceptance, and the transition process. This podcast is part of the wider UCL Grand Challenges funded project ‘Coping with Menopause: exploring women’s lived experiences of work and the multigenerational squeeze’.https://www.ucl.ac.uk/grand-challenges/impacts-and-outputs/podcastsDate of episode recording: 2024-07-25T00:00:00ZDuration: 00:40:48Language of episode: English (UK)Presenter:Meena Khatwa; Kelly DicksonGuests: Sonia Abrams; Lauren Chiren; Josephine FaladeProducer: Phil Mason, Meena Khatwa, Kelly DicksonTranscription link: https://otter.ai/u/CDPELeb9YvZIcxTBpUu5z11ZJMw?utm_source=copy_url
